- 3. An adventitious sound, usually of morbid origin, accompanying the normal respiratory sounds. See Rhonchus. Note: Various kinds are distinguished by pathologists; differing in intensity, as loud and small; in quality, as moist, dry, clicking, and sonorous; and in origin, as tracheal, pulmonary, and pleural.
